Sheila Marie Sandula (Lehr) passed away unexpectedly while on vacation with her family in Mammoth Lakes, California in the Sierra Mountains.
Sheila was born October 25, 1942 in Detroit to Norman and Sylvia (Dugelar) Lehr. She devoted her life to her family and was a surrogate mother to many. She loved to travel and loved animals, especially horses, and enjoyed nature. Her move to Northern Michigan in 1984 was a dream come true. Her father nicknamed her "Tuff" and this was a good description of her personality. She survived many tough situations in her life and made many lifelong friends along the way. Through her dialysis and radiation, she always had a smile and made people laugh. Even though she had health concerns, she was a spitfire who had a strong determination for life.
She was greeted in heaven by her parents, aunt Ruby Madar, niece Charlotte Lehr, and great grandson Cayden Nelson.
